
Hard water can irritate your skin, dull your clothes, and leave unsightly stains on your fixtures. Fortunately, installing a DIY water softener is a feasible project that can solve these problems. This step-by-step guide will walk you through the process, equipping you with the knowledge to cleanse your water and enjoy its many benefits.
- Before you begin, evaluate your water hardness level using a home test kit. This will help you select the right size softener for your needs.
- Identify a suitable spot near your main water line. Ensure it's accessible for maintenance and has adequate space for the unit.
- Carefully comply with the manufacturer's instructions provided with your DIY water softener kit.
- Connect the bypass valve, brine tank, and control valve to the main water line. Ensure all connections are secure and leak-proof.
- Fill the brine tank with the advised salt solution according to the manufacturer's instructions.
- Configure the softener's settings based on your water usage and hardness level.
- Test the softened water by running it through faucets and appliances to confirm its effectiveness.
With a little effort, you can successfully install a DIY water softener and experience the rewards of soft, clean water.
Mastering Maintenance: Preserve Your Water Softener Running Smoothly
A well-maintained water softener can deliver spotless water for years to come. To ensure your system runs efficiently and effectively, implement a regular maintenance schedule. Initiate by checking the brine tank level regularly, adding salt as needed to maintain optimal functionality. Inspect the resin beads periodically for signs of damage. If you notice any discoloration or buildup, consider a professional cleaning. Remember, prompt maintenance can mitigate costly repairs and extend the lifespan of your water softener.
- Schedule regular checkups with a qualified technician for in-depth inspections and adjustments.
- Purge the system periodically to remove sediment buildup and maintain optimal performance.
- Track water hardness levels regularly and adjust softener settings as needed.
Selecting the Right Water Softener System for Your Home
Deciding on a water softener can feel overwhelming with all the options available. A properly configured system is essential for optimally softening your water and ensuring it meets your household's needs. Start by determining your water hardness level using a test kit from your local hardware store. This data will help you identify the right flow rate for your softener. Consider the level of water your maintenance water softener systems household requires daily, as well as the amount of people living in your home. A good rule of thumb is to select a system that can handle at least one and a half times your average daily water usage.
- Investigate different types of softeners, such as salt-based, salt-free, and potassium chloride systems, to find the best option for your preferences.
- Compare features like regeneration cycle length, effectiveness, and installation complexity before making a purchase.
- Don't forget to review online ratings from other homeowners to acquire valuable perspectives about different brands and models.

Water Softener Installation: Essential Tips for Success
Installing a water softener can seem daunting initially, but with a little planning and these essential tips, you'll be on your way to enjoying softer water in no time. First and foremost, choose a location for your softener that is easily accessible. Ensure there's adequate space for the unit itself. Next, carefully review the manufacturer's instructions before launching into the process. Remember to shut off the main water supply and drain any existing pipes before attaching the softener.
After installation, be sure to flush the system thoroughly to remove any particles. This will ensure optimal operation. Finally, regularly check your softener's performance and recharge it as needed. By following these tips, you can guarantee a smooth and successful water softener installation.
